The International English Language Testing System (IELTS) is a globally acknowledged English proficiency test that evaluates a candidate's capability to interact in English throughout 4 crucial areas: listening, reading, composing, and speaking. Whether you are preparing to study abroad, move to an English-speaking nation, or advance your career, the IELTS exam is frequently a crucial step in achieving your goals. This detailed guide will stroll you through the procedure of purchasing and preparing for the IELTS exam, guaranteeing you are well-equipped to be successful.

Understanding the IELTS Exam

Before diving into the registration process, it's vital to understand what the IELTS exam involves. The IELTS is offered in two formats:

  1. Academic IELTS: Designed for people who desire to study at an undergraduate or postgraduate level in an English-speaking country.
  2. General Training IELTS: Suitable for those who are preparing to work, train, or move to an English-speaking nation.

How to Register for the IELTS Exam

Registering for the IELTS exam is a simple procedure, however it requires mindful attention to information. Here's a detailed guide to assist you through the registration procedure:

  1. Choose the Right Format: Decide whether you require to take the Academic or General Training IELTS based upon your goals.
  2. Find a Test Center: Visit the official IELTS site to discover a test center near you. You can likewise check the schedule of test dates.
  3. Develop an Account: Sign up for an account on the IELTS website. You will need to offer personal info, including your name, date of birth, and contact information.
  4. Select a Test Date and Time: Choose a test date and time that suits your schedule. Keep in mind that some test centers might offer both computer-delivered and paper-based tests.
  5. Pay the Exam Fee: The expense of the IELTS exam varies by country and test center. Payment can usually be made online utilizing a credit card or through other payment approaches specified by the test center.
  6. Confirm Your Registration: After completing the payment, you will receive a confirmation email with your test details. Make certain to evaluate this information and keep it for your records.

Preparing for the IELTS Exam

Preparation is essential to carrying out well on the IELTS exam. Here are some ideas to help you prepare efficiently:

  1. Familiarize Yourself with the Format: Understand the structure and timing of each area. Practice with sample tests to get a feel for the kinds of questions you will experience.
  2. Enhance Your Language Skills: Focus on improving your listening, reading, writing, and speaking abilities. Usage resources like IELTS practice books, online courses, and language exchange programs.
  3. Take Practice Tests: Regularly take practice tests to evaluate your development and recognize areas for enhancement. Numerous test centers and online platforms provide free or paid practice tests.
  4. Deal With Time Management: The IELTS exam is time-pressured, so practice finishing jobs within the designated time. This will assist you manage your time efficiently throughout the actual exam.
  5. Look for Feedback: If possible, get feedback from a teacher or tutor. They can offer important insights and assist you improve your abilities.

Frequently asked questions

Q: How long are IELTS scores legitimate?A: IELTS scores stand for 2 years from the date of the test. Nevertheless, some institutions and organizations may have different validity durations, so it's always best to contact them directly.

Q: Can I retake the IELTS exam if I am not pleased with my score?A: Yes, you can retake the IELTS exam as numerous times as you need to. Nevertheless, it's crucial to prepare completely before retaking the test to improve your score.

Q: What is the distinction between the computer-delivered and paper-based IELTS?A: The material and structure of both formats are the very same. The only distinction is the approach of shipment. The computer-delivered IELTS is handled a computer system, while the paper-based IELTS is taken with pen and paper. The speaking test is conducted face-to-face in both formats.

Q: How do I receive my IELTS results?A: You can view your IELTS results online 13 days after your test date. Official Test Report Forms (TRFs) are usually sent to you and any organizations you have actually designated within 13 days of the test.
